New Rose Bush Leaves Are Shriveled And Curling

Question From: WASHINGTON
Q: I have just notice that there are new leaves on my rose bushes that are shriveled and curling. The bushes ended their dormant period about a month ago so that the bushes are just beginning to leaf. This is a new occurrence that only became apparent in the last few days.

A: When roses begin to leaf out a sudden cold snap can kill t the leaves. Most shrubs have latent buds that will produce a new set of leaves. Use of high nitrogen chemical fertilizers stimulate excessive spring growth early in the season that's more easily damaged by frost.
